Throughout the House of the Dead series, zombies are the primary enemies. Though appearing in many different shapes, sizes, and even species, all have the same goal: to kill any living being that crosses their path.

Notably, some zombies have appeared in multiple games. These include Kageo, Ebitan, Murrer, Devilon, and Johnny.

The House of the Dead: Overkill

Unlike the first four installments, the cast of zombies - or "mutants" as they're called in this game - almost completely consist of the zombified/mutated/infected residents of Bayou City rather than duplicates of the same reanimated corpses. THis is also the first HotD game to feature female zombies. These zombies range from common civilians, hospital workers, clowns, prison inmates, and law enforcers, varying from location to location. They are armed with knives, hammers, axes, sickles, saws, bottles, riot sticks and shields (police mutants/zombies only), their bare hands, body parts of dead mutants/zombies, and even their own bodies (Pukers only).
